Dave H
Ultra New Town Tavern Ultra New Town Tavern
Las Vegas, Nevada
"Dave H"
Local Bar located in beautiful Celebration Florida. Its a New England style bar that fits in right along with communities it lies within. Food is great, happy hour is decent but its only offered at the bar. They have Trivia nights on Monday which are always fun from Puzzles Entertainment. The place is typicall crowded and has a 20-45 min wait if you get there during the dinner rush. Staffing is great, very friendly, willing to make what you want. They do special events for holidays which are fun. They have 2 outdoor seating areas both can be covered in case of rain 1 with a bar and an inside bar as well as a regular dining area. They have a loyalty program with reward points. The prices arent to extreme and are definitely reasonable